Merge git://git.kernel.org/pub/scm/linux/kernel/git/davem/net
Conflicts: drivers/net/ethernet/altera/altera_sgdma.c net/netlink/af_netlink.c net/sched/cls_api.c net/sched/sch_api.c The netlink conflict dealt with moving to netlink_capable() and netlink_ns_capable() in the 'net' tree vs. supporting 'tc' operations in non-init namespaces. These were simple transformations from netlink_capable to netlink_ns_capable. The Altera driver conflict was simply code removal overlapping some void pointer cast cleanups in net-next.
